Top 5 Idle RPG Apps on Android in Estonia: Q2 2024
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 Idle RPG applications on the Android platform in Estonia for Q2 2024, based on Sensor Tower data.
In the second quarter of 2024, the top 5 Idle RPG applications on the Android platform in Estonia showed varied performance in terms of weekly downloads and revenue. Here’s a detailed look at their trends,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Legend of Mushroom from Joy Nice Games experienced a fluctuating revenue trend, peaking at $210 in the week of April 8 and then gradually declining to $65 by mid-June, before slightly rebounding to $89 in the final week of June. Weekly downloads also showed a downward trend, starting from 433 in early April and dropping to single digits in May, with a slight increase to 28 by the end of June.
Legend of Slime: Idle RPG War by AppQuantum saw a significant increase in weekly revenue, starting from $43 in early April and reaching a peak of $114 in the final week of May. Downloads started at 83 in the first week of April, dropped to 4 in late April, and then gradually climbed back up to 60 by the end of June.
Nobody's Adventure Chop-Chop from 37GAMES GLOBAL showed a remarkable increase in weekly revenue, starting from $1 in early April and peaking at $67 in mid-June. Downloads saw a notable spike in the last week of May, reaching 157, and subsequently showed a decline, ending at 17 in the final week of June.
Slime Castle — Idle TD Game by Azur Interactive Games Limited, released in early May, saw a steady increase in weekly revenue, starting from $29 in the third week of May and peaking at $76 by the end of June. Weekly downloads followed a similar upward trend, beginning at 17 in early May and reaching 74 by the last week of June.
Slime Village from Seikami had a relatively stable revenue trend, peaking at $30 in early April and then gradually declining to $2 by mid-June. Weekly downloads showed a peak of 73 in the second week of April, followed by fluctuations, and ending at 4 in the last week of June.
